From: Theo Date: Thu, 22 Feb 2018 06:51:09 +0000 (+0100) Subject: fix: missing ! when checking regex pointer X-Git-Tag: neomutt-20180223~1 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=a45635c4ab17db5859ed7cccfa9d7611ddece4e2;p=neomutt fix: missing ! when checking regex pointer --- diff --git a/mutt/regex.c b/mutt/regex.c index 2d77e3ab6..2c67af856 100644 --- a/mutt/regex.c +++ b/mutt/regex.c @@ -217,7 +217,7 @@ bool mutt_regexlist_match(struct RegexList *rl, const char *str) for (; rl; rl = rl->next) { - if (!rl->regex || rl->regex->regex) + if (!rl->regex || !rl->regex->regex) continue; if (regexec(rl->regex->regex, str, (size_t) 0, (regmatch_t *) 0, (int) 0) == 0) {